Operational Modal Analysis Synopsis

This book is a collection of selected contributions from the 10th International Operational Modal Analysis (OMA) Conference held in Naples, Italy on May 21-24, 2024. Each chapter of Operational Modal Analysis: Developments and Applications covers a relevant contribution to extend the classical domain of OMA toward the development of new sensing as well as structural health monitoring (SHM) technologies, digital twins, and innovative assessment procedures for materials and structures. The focus of these chapters is on the primary role of OMA in civil engineering as well as related industrial applications and fields. Thus, the book provides an up-to-date overview of OMA applications and related technologies and methodologies and can support researchers, practicing engineers, and technicians, as well as students in order to enhance their knowledge on this important topic.

Features

  • Presents numerous application examples and case studies.
  • Shows how advanced AI technologies contribute to the progress of methodologies and techniques of OMA and SHM in the field.
  • Introduces the applicability of OMA for the devlopment of structural digital twins.
